quote:
why do you say that? Why is a hash different than words in a book?
IMO, IP like a book or even an idea has value because it entertains, instructs, and/or explains events that happened in the real world.
The information that makes up a bitcoin does none of this. It only has value within the confines of the BC network.
I can write a book from scratch (even a crappy one) that someone would possibly buy. If I use a random number generator to produce hash tags the network will reject them as worthless.
